Transaction 42f21476f789a71fea2e39fa7b5ccc4479d0a50f30cfabba1e94b229d1dcb4b1
2 Input
2 Outputs
- 42f21476f789a71fea2e39fa7b5ccc4479d0a50f30cfabba1e94b229d1dcb4b1:0
- 42f21476f789a71fea2e39fa7b5ccc4479d0a50f30cfabba1e94b229d1dcb4b1:1
value 1211101
address 12eNaCfU7nenGMJ83ADwf8dst3N3ZXEBUv
value 11315178
address 38QchtEUD7JLiMgdQwAJGAge6Bvpef3QjA